What's the best time for 2 week adventure tours in Asia?
The best timing depends on where you're headed. For Nepal treks, plan for October-November or March-April when skies are clear for mountain views. Sri Lanka has two monsoon patterns - southwest from May to September and northeast from October to January. India tours are most enjoyable from October to March when temperatures stay between 68-86°F (20-30°C). Many travelers suggest skipping peak summer (April-June) since places like Rajasthan can get really hot, often above 104°F (40°C).
What type of accommodation can I expect on 2 week adventure tours?
You'll stay in a mix of places, from nice 3-4 star hotels in cities to simpler lodges in remote spots. Sri Lanka tours use places like the 4-star Regal Reseau Hotel and Spa in Negombo and Cardamon Hotel in Trincomalee. When trekking in Nepal, you'll sleep in basic but cozy teahouses and lodges. India tours typically book 3-star hotels like the Topaz Hotel in Kandy, with AC and WiFi. Some tours include special stays like desert camps in Jaisalmer or houseboats in Kerala's backwaters.
How much wildlife viewing is included in 2 week adventure tours?
You'll get plenty of chances to see wildlife, especially in national parks. In Sri Lanka, you'll go on jeep safaris in Yala and Wilpattu parks to look for leopards, elephants and lots of birds. Nepal's Chitwan park offers rhino spotting, elephant visits and river trips. In India's Ranthambore park, you'll usually get two game drives to search for tigers. Early morning safaris give you the best shot at seeing animals, and expert guides help spot wildlife you might miss on your own.
